Man arrested in NLV in stabbing case
FULLERTON, Calif. -- Police have made an arrest in the stabbing of two men in a Fullerton movie theater.
Fullerton police Sgt. Linda King said Steven Walter Robinson Jr. was arrested early Friday in North Las Vegas.
King said a person who recognized Robinson provided information to Fullerton police.
She said witnesses had identified Robinson through Department of Motor Vehicles photos.
Fullerton police reported that the two victims were stabbed last month during a showing of the horror film "The Signal" at an AMC theater.
In "The Signal," a transmission invades cell phones, radios and TVs, turning people into killers.
King said Robinson is being held in North Las Vegas pending extradition to Orange County.
